Hydration: Depends on your history . If you have chronic constipation then difficult problem. Also depends what you are calling constipation. Noal bowel movements can be once in three days for some. But short of that drink lots of fluids and can use stool softeners . Most meds contain senekot which is irritates the bowel and chronic use can make things worse.
